Simplify ((csc^2x)(sin^4x+cos^2x))/(cos^2x) - cos^2x = tan^2x*csc^2x+cot^2x+sin^2x-1

LS = ((csc^2x)(sin^4x+cos^2x))/(cos^2x) - cos^2x
= (1/sin^2 x)(sin^4 x + cos^2 x)/cos^2 x - cos^2 x
= (sin^2 x + cos^2 x/sin^2 x)/cos^2 x - cos^2 x
= sin^2 x/cos^2 x + 1/sin^2 x - cos^2 x
= tan^2 x + csc^2 x - cos^2 x
RS = tan^2x*csc^2x+cot^2x+sin^2x-1
= sin^2 x/cos^2 x * 1/sin^2 x + cos^2 x/ sin^2 x - 1
= 1/cos^2 x + cos^2 x /sin^2 x - 1
